    @Razor2048 ปีที่แล้ว +2

    Cyberpunk has issues with multi-CPU systems, where some of its processes can end up being assigned to an entirely separate CPU. Beyond that from other tests, it seems many games start to run into issues after 64 cores.
    PC, photoshop also has issues when there are a large number of cores and threads.
